The Premier League division of the Neath Tuesday Netball League saw intense action in the 12th week, reflecting the high standard of competition characteristic of the league. With only two weeks left in the season, every point scored holds immense value in the race for the top spot.
In the Premier League, big players made big moves. The Steelers and Spice Goals battled it out in a close encounter, with the Steelers emerging victorious with a score of 16-12. The Sweaty Betty's showcased their supremacy and lived up to their reputation with an overwhelming 20-7 victory over the Shooting Stars. In another match-up, Pitch Slap dominated the court against Hoops I Did It Again, securing a commanding 22-2 win.
Sweaty Betty's player, Jo Smith, was in a league of her own and was rightfully named the most valued player of the week. Her exceptional skills and sheer determination were instrumental in Sweaty Betty's victory. She's undoubtedly a player to keep an eye on in the remaining weeks.
